What to expect

The Centre Historique de Lille is a charming area with a rich history and architecture. Visitors can stroll through its colorful streets, admire the beautiful façades, and explore the many shops and restaurants. The Vieux-Lille is particularly notable for its well-preserved architecture and lively atmosphere. Families can enjoy a visit to the quai du Wault, a former port area that now offers a beautiful spot for a picnic or a leisurely walk. The area is also close to other attractions, such as the Palais des Beaux-Arts and the Citadelle. With its unique blend of history, culture, and entertainment, the Centre Historique de Lille is a great destination for families to explore
